Mar. 22 Ernst Wilhelm Sachs killed by an avalanche: On Easter Monday, April 11thm 1977, Ernst Wilhelm Sachs (ERNST WIHELM SACHS - our picture) was killed by an avalanche. The 48 years old industrialist of Schweinfurt spent holidays in the French Alps. By helicopter he flew - accompanied by a ski-instructor and an alpin-guide-from Val d'Isere to the Boucher-masaif and started the downhill run in 3000m. In a small passage Ernst Wilhelm Sachs was buried by an avalanche. When he was found about 30 minutes later, he has been dead. Ernst Wilhelm Sachs was, together with the younger brother Gunter, the owner of the well-known Fichtel and Sachs- concern in Schweinfurt/ West Germany
